Free songs
Home / Bootcamp de programación / La Programación y el Desarrollo de Software en 2021

La Programación y el Desarrollo de Software en 2021

En el mundo de la programación y desarrollo de software, la experiencia práctica es a menudo tan valiosa como la educación formal. Estos profesionales habilidosos traducen las necesidades y deseos de los usuarios en un código funcional, también desempeñan un papel crucial en el diseño conceptual y la planificación detallada de las aplicaciones y sistemas. El desarrollo de software es un proceso integral y multifacético, esencial en la creación y mantenimiento de aplicaciones, frameworks y otros componentes de software.

  • La carrera de Desarrollo Web le permite adquirir los conocimientos y habilidades que necesita para idear, diseñar, modelar, programar, asegurar, implementar y probar sitios y aplicaciones web simples y de alto grado de complejidad, destinadas a utilizarse por miles o millones de usuarios.
  • Los pasos del proceso de desarrollo de software se integran en  la gestión del ciclo de vida de aplicaciones  (ALM).
  • Según un informe reciente, el 72% de las organizaciones planea implementar o ha implementado alguna forma de desarrollo sin código en su empresa.
  • Con una comprensión clara de las diferencias entre programación y desarrollo de software, los aspirantes a desarrolladores pueden enfocar sus habilidades y esfuerzos en la dirección correcta para lograr sus objetivos profesionales.

Si hacemos una clasificación según las funciones del software veremos que podemos agruparlo en cuatro categorías bien definidas y bastante distintas unas de otras. Además, el informe también reveló que el 68% de las organizaciones que implementaron el desarrollo de software sin código experimentaron una disminución en los costos de desarrollo. Una vez realizada exitosamente la instalación del software, el mismo pasa a la fase de producción (operatividad), durante la cual cumple las funciones para las que fue desarrollado, es decir, es finalmente utilizado por el (o los) usuario final, produciendo los resultados esperados. El modelo Win & Win hace énfasis en la negociación inicial, también introduce 3 hitos en el proceso llamados «puntos de fijación», que ayudan a establecer la completitud de un ciclo de la espiral, y proporcionan hitos de decisión antes de continuar el proyecto de desarrollo del software.

¿Quién es el Técnico de proyectos editoriales?

En contraste, el desarrollo de software sin código utiliza herramientas visuales e intuitivas que solo requieren conocimientos de programación y experiencia en “no code” y/o “low code”. En resumen, las características clave de las plataformas de desarrollo sin código incluyen una interfaz visual e intuitiva, capacidad de personalización y amplias integraciones, lo que las convierte en herramientas poderosas para capacitar a las empresas y optimizar sus operaciones. Las estadísticas demuestran el crecimiento y la adopción del desarrollo de software sin código en las empresas. Según un informe reciente, el 72% de las organizaciones planea implementar o ha implementado alguna forma de desarrollo sin código en su empresa. Esto demuestra la creciente popularidad y reconocimiento de los beneficios que ofrece esta metodología.

Espacios de trabajo Red Hat CodeReady automatiza aplicaciones o microservicios a cualquier número de servidores. Es una de las mejores herramientas de desarrollo de software que automatiza completamente las implementaciones de https://www.pronetwork.mx/aprende-a-programar-con-el-curso-de-desarrollo-web-de-tripleten/ archivos de texto y binarios desde cualquier número de servidores de destino. Es una de las mejores herramientas de desarrollo de software que automatiza aplicaciones o microservicios para cualquier cantidad de servidores.

¿Por Qué es Importante el Desarrollo de Software?

La instalación del software es el proceso por el cual los programas desarrollados son transferidos apropiadamente al computador destino, inicializados, y, finalmente, configurados; todo ello con el propósito de ser ya utilizados por el usuario final. Luego de esta el producto entrará en la fase de funcionamiento y producción, para el que fuera diseñado. Debido a la naturaleza “intangible” del software, y dependiendo de las herramientas que se utilizan en el proceso, la frontera entre el curso de desarrollo web diseño y la codificación también puede ser virtualmente imposible de identificar. Por ejemplo, algunas herramientas CASE son capaces de generar código a partir de diagramas UML, los que describen gráficamente la estructura de un sistema software. El modelo es aconsejable para el desarrollo de software en el cual se observe, en su etapa inicial de análisis, que posee áreas bastante bien definidas a cubrir, con suficiente independencia como para ser desarrolladas en etapas sucesivas.

  • La primera generación de lenguajes de programación consistía enteramente de una secuencia de 0s y 1s que los controles de la computadora interpreta como instrucciones, eléctricamente.
  • En resumen, la programación de software es la creación de instrucciones y algoritmos para que los ordenadores realicen tareas específicas.
  • Estos elementos trabajan en conjunto para convertir las instrucciones escritas por los programadores en código máquina, que es el lenguaje que entiende la computadora.
  • Puede desarrollar una aplicación utilizando una única base de código HTML5, CSS3, JavaScript y PHP.

Por otro lado, el desarrollo de software es el proceso completo de crear un programa o aplicación, desde la planificación y el diseño hasta la implementación y el mantenimiento. El software de programación es un conjunto de herramientas que permiten al programador desarrollar programas, usando diferentes alternativas y lenguajes de programación de manera práctica. El lenguaje mencionado es altamente formal, que por medio de algoritmos, permiten desarrollar instrucciones y modificaciones en los accionares de diversos sistemas.

Scroll To Top